P RICE, J., filed a concurring statement.
CONCURRING STATEMENT
I agree that the applicant’s second claim, complaining of the erroneous assessment of attorney fees, is not cognizable by way of an application for writ of habeas corpus. It should be dismissed. I write separately simply to note that the applicant may obtain relief from those fees by raising this claim in an application for writ of mandamus, as we have previously held that “questions of the validity of orders entered under [Article 26.05(g), Code of Criminal Procedure] . . . constitute ‘criminal law matters’ for purposes of our mandamus
